Choosing The Right Topic For LinkedIn

Picking a compelling subject for your posts can truly elevate your presence on this platform. Start by diving into your own expertise—what do you genuinely love discussing? Sharing your unique insights can lead to audience engagement, making your content more relatable and fostering meaningful interactions.

Next, keep an eye on popular trends.

Engaging with current industry discussions not only enhances your visibility but also helps establish your thought leadership.

Focus on themes that resonate with your personal branding, attracting professionals who share similar interests.

This way, you’ll cultivate a thriving community around your passions.

Take a look back at your earlier posts. Identify which pieces garnered the most engagement, and consider crafting more content along those lines. Tips For Effective Article Writing

Connecting with your readers is all about making a personal touch. To really engage your audience, focusing on audience targeting is essential.

Think about what they want to learn and how you can meet those needs.

Visual content can also enhance your articles, breaking up text and making it more appealing.

Incorporating images or infographics can complement your words beautifully. Storytelling techniques are another great way to draw readers in, weaving a narrative that keeps them hooked.

Always make sure to include a call to action at the end of your article. Encourage readers to take the next step, whether it’s commenting or sharing your work.

Using SEO Optimization For Visibility

When it comes to standing out in the crowded blogosphere, it’s not just the quality of your writing that matters; it’s about making smart choices along the way. Crafting compelling content while enhancing online visibility can feel like a balancing act.

Think of SEO as your best friend, guiding readers directly to your work.

Many bloggers get caught up in misunderstandings, like the idea that simply cramming keywords into a post will lead to success.

Instead, let’s prioritize genuine connections and meaningful insights.

Keyword research is a game changer for your content journey. Finding the right phrases tailored to your audience’s interests is essential.

Tools such as Google Keyword Planner and Ubersuggest can help you pinpoint these key terms effortlessly.

Analyzing Engagement Metrics For Improvement

Keeping a finger on the pulse of audience interaction is key to moving forward. Let’s dive into what these metrics can reveal.

Engagement measurements like likes, shares, and comments showcase how your audience engages with your content.

Analyzing these figures can help refine your strategy and support follower growth.

When it comes to tools for tracking, there are countless options.

Google Analytics and social media insights offer precious data. Use this knowledge to tweak your post frequency and enhance multimedia integration.

Avoid the trap of fixating on vanity metrics; focus on real engagement that sparks meaningful conversations.
